On the Debt Dad Podcast, Brad Nelson (founder of Debt Free Dad) explains why many people struggle financially even with decent income and hard work, arguing that daily money decisions are often shaped by outside influences: how you were raised, marketing, and social influence.

He discusses research on financial socialization, including that core money habits can form by age seven, and how inherited beliefs about stress, spending, saving, and debt can become default adult behaviors. He outlines how marketing targets emotions and promotes “easy payments,” causing people to stack obligations that consume future income. He also covers social comparison and findings from The Millionaire Next Door showing that affluent environments can increase pressure to spend, while modest surroundings can help build wealth.
